The Dunamis Project vs Dunamis Essentials
The Dunamis Project is the central training of DFC to help you cooperate with the Holy Spirit in whatever ministry you may have, in whatever part of the world you may live. It is a series of 6 conferences, 4 or 5 full days each, over a 3-year period with solid biblical teaching about the person and work of the Holy Spirit in the life of the believer.
Dunamis Essentials is an abridged version of each of the 6 Dunamis Projects, still over 3 years, where we teach the content in a condensed time frame, either on-line or in-person. You will get to experience live teaching, small groups and worship together. Our goal is to make the Dunamis teachings more accessible to more people.
